Output 83fd06159942fd3bb564715f59fe35a1aff15cb8eca5685ded00d7cf70524d9a:0

value
995766
script pubkey
OP_0 OP_PUSHBYTES_20 e038a32c1207555951bc4aacd02aa05e84aa5a74
address
bc1ququ2xtqjqa24j5duf2kdq24qt6z25kn5qde7as
transaction
83fd06159942fd3bb564715f59fe35a1aff15cb8eca5685ded00d7cf70524d9a
spent
true